Blog
Open Menu, Close Menu – Accessible and Responsive NavigationOpen Menu, Close Menu – Accessible and Responsive Navigation">

Open Menu, Close Menu – Accessible and Responsive Navigation

Alexandra Dimitriou, GetBoat.com
podle 
Alexandra Dimitriou, GetBoat.com
9 minut čtení
Blog
Říjen 24, 2025

Recommendation: Zaveďte okamžitě ovládání primárně pomocí klávesnice; zajistěte viditelné obrysy fokusů, odkazy pro přeskočení, označené orientační body, role ARIA, jasné pojmenování ovládacích prvků a předvídatelné pořadí procházení pomocí tabulátoru. To zvyšuje viditelnost na všech zařízeních a usnadňuje život uživatelům na všech plochách, zejména při časově náročných úlohách.

Přístup implementace: Začněte přepínačem, který na vyžádání zobrazí úplný seznam; na malých obrazovkách udržujte viditelnou kompaktní hlavičku; globální přepínač zůstává v celém regionu na očích; použijte stabilní strukturu, která usnadní objevování života během cest mezi ostrovy, ranních rutin a místních jízd. Zahrňte skip odkazy, klíčové role, popisné názvy, stručné štítky; zvyšte viditelnost pomocí vysokého kontrastu, velkých prvků pro klepnutí, minimální náročnosti pro většinu zařízení, skálopevného základu.

Structure: Mělká, předvídatelná hierarchie udržuje stabilní horní vrstvu na všech obrazovkách; vyhněte se efektu pohyblivého písku, kde se možnosti skrývají před zraky; použijte vzor taputimu k navádění pohybu zaostření, když uživatelé prozkoumávají mezioblastní regiony; každá stránka oblasti obsahuje stručný název, viditelné ovládání domovské stránky a místní podmnožinu příkazů; to odráží život regionu pro uživatele, kteří obvykle začínají úkoly během ranních túr.

Plán testování: Zkontrolujte pořadí klávesových zkratek s testerem v rukavicích; ověřte viditelnost na jasném světle napříč zařízeními; respektujte skutečně minimální nastavení pohybu; změřte, zda se neztrácí čas zbytečnými přechody; zkontrolujte toky mezi ostrovy; sbírejte zpětnou vazbu od turistů, místních převozníků, ranních průzkumníků; udržujte vysokou viditelnost živých organismů.

Kontrolní seznam implementace: Seřaďte prvky, na které se dá zaměřit, do pořádku; označte orientační body; přidejte přeskočení odkazů; zajistěte velké dotykové prvky; používejte škálovatelnou typografii; testujte pomocí čteček obrazovky; postupně nasazujte na regionální weby; sledujte metriky, které nabízejí rychlé výhry; udržujte akce snadno dostupné; pomozte uživatelům rychle se vrátit zpět na domovskou stránku.

Americká Samoa – cestovní průvodce

Přileťte na mezinárodní letiště Pago Pago; pronajměte si vozidlo přímo u obrubníku pro flexibilní začátek. Pronájmy podél pobřeží umožňují snadný přístup do Matautuloa, Alega Beach; vyhlídky podél silnice do vnitrozemí. Cestovatelé hledající autentickou kulturu Americké Samoy zde naleznou rovnováhu mezi útesovými proudy, útesovými kavárnami a vřelou pohostinností.

Pobřeží Matautuloa nabízí skalní útvary, přílivové tůně a větřík vonící solí. Odtud lze z výběžku pozorovat západ slunce a sledovat živé barevné proměny nad zátokami Tutuily. Cesty podél pobřeží vybízejí k pomalému cestování; u každé zatáčky prodávají rodiny čerstvé ovoce.

Neuvěřitelná místa pro šnorchlování se nacházejí poblíž okraje útesu; proudy nejsou během silných přílivů shovívavé, proto si před vstupem do vody zkontrolujte místní tabulky přílivů a odlivů. Není potřeba žádné luxusní vybavení; půjčte si šnorchl na místním trhu, zabalte si opalovací krém bezpečný pro korály, jednoduché vybavení funguje dobře.

Možnosti pro rozpočet zahrnují malé penziony, pobyty v komunitách, plus matautuloa fale neboli útulné chatky u moře; náklady zůstávají pro cestovatele rozumné. Snadná doprava po silnici; pobřežní kavárny nabízejí autentické samojské chutě s plody chlebovníku, tarou, ulu, kokosem. Jídla při západu slunce poblíž přístavu nabízejí živou hudbu, vřelou atmosféru. Sbalte si malý batoh s vodou, opalovacím krémem bezpečným pro korály a lehkou nepromokavou bundou.

Půjčovny vybavení zahrnují jízdní kola, kajaky, šnorchlovací vybavení; obchody mají sady nádobí bohler. Pro delší pobyty se hodí vybavená pronajatá dodávka; ceny paliva na americkém území zůstávají mírné. Vesnice Matautuloa vítají respektující návštěvníky; vybavení bohler pomáhá s přípravou kempu.

Existují silniční trasy nabízející pobřežní výhledy, skalnaté útesy, zarostlé stezky v džungli. Jakmile uvidíte Matautulou z útesu, pochopíte, proč se sem cestovatelé vracejí. Postavte si tábor na klidném návrší s výhledem na přístav; pozorujte delfíny skákavé za soumraku během teplých měsíců.

Možnosti pro jednodenní výlety zahrnují historii vraků lodí, ananasové farmy, kulturní expozice v centrech vesnic. Letecké doplňování zásob je rychlá obnova; okružní jízda po ostrově po silnici odhaluje výhledy na matautuloa, pobřežní scenérie a vřelou pohostinnost na každé zastávce.

Označení ARIA a role pro přepínač nabídky

Označení ARIA a role pro přepínač nabídky

Recommendation: Použijte popisný atribut aria-label u prvku ovládání; odkazujte na panel pomocí aria-controls; přiřazení role=”button” ke spoušti; zrcadlit viditelný stav pomocí aria-expanded: false při zavření; true při otevření; panel používá role=”region”; aria-labelledby spojené se spouštěčem.

Tipy pro implementaci: Zachovejte stabilní ID pro panel, např. id=”site-panel”; zajistěte, aby spouštěč nesl ID ”site-trigger”; aria-labelledby v oblasti odkazuje na trigger; aria-controls Po stisknutí spouště odkazuje na panel; při kliknutí nebo stisknutí klávesy přepnout. aria-expanded; aktualizace aria-hidden v panelu tak, aby odpovídal stavu; otestujte pomocí čtečky obrazovky a ověřte pořadí čtení; pohyb fokusu zůstává logický.

Věnujte čas testování se čtečkou obrazovky a současně poslouchejte pořadí čtení; pamatujte, že chybějící popisky uživatele uvězní na tržišti možností; ty bílé by mohly přepínač obléct jednoduchou ikonou a popisným textem; zachovejte jedinečnost v označování; rajské obrazy, jako laguna v Samoi, posilují srozumitelnost; otevřený stav by měl být ohlášen rychle; čekací doby musí být krátké; rychlé přepínání snižuje hrubé přechody; laguny, divoká zvěř, kontrasty bosých nohou pomáhají zprostředkovat stav bez nepořádku; dopravní metafory, jako je klidná prohlídka laguny po strmé cestě, provázejí designéry tokem; jen několik dobře zvolených pojmů udržuje čas strávený rolováním na minimu.

Ověření: Ověřte část po části; total skóre závisí na konzistentním označování; ověřte předvídatelný stav pomocí klávesnice, čteček obrazovky, dotykového vstupu napříč zařízeními; zajistěte, aby se otevřený stav okamžitě ohlásil; potvrďte aria-hidden matches aria-expanded; všimněte si, že rychlé přepnutí zabraňuje chybnému čtení obsahu během přechodu; zkontrolujte barevný kontrast, zejména bílý text na tmavém pozadí; výsledkem by měl být jedinečný, plynulý a přenositelný pocit napříč svahy.

Navigace klávesnicí: pořadí fokusů, Tab, Shift+Tab a Escape

Začněte frontu zaměření s prvním interaktivním prvkem v pořadí dokumentu; zdroj předvídatelného toku pro vašeho návštěvníka, zejména během ranních návštěv nebo celoročních prohlídek města, kde záleží na bezpečnosti a historických výhledech.

Tab přesune fokus na další prvek, Shift+Tab přesune fokus zpět, uvnitř panelu.

Úniková klávesa vrací fokus do hlavní oblasti, která otevřela panel, což je část ovládacího rozhraní, a poskytuje tak rychlý reset pro uživatele, který si dává pozor.

Pro snížení kognitivní zátěže udržujte seznam cílů krátký, základní; minimalizuje se tím rozptýlení, zvyšuje bezpečnost, posiluje klid, signály dostupnosti pro ostatní.

Rozvržení v domácím prostředí obvykle odráží vizuální pořádek: orientační body, jako je domovská stránka; vyhledávání; místní informace; mapy v kontextu ostrova sledují logickou sekvenci pro snadný průchod rozhraním.

Při testování přemýšlejte o analogii s jízdou taxíkem: trasa by měla být jasná, omezená a opakovatelná; návštěvník by se měl ke každému ovládacímu prvku dostat bez zmatků.

Element Očekávané chování fokusu Poznámky
Domů Získává soustředění po dopadu snadno dostupné; obvykle v záhlaví
Hledaný vstup Získá fokus ihned po načtení základní interakce, rychlý přístup
Přepnout tlačítko panelu Získá fokus během cesty vpřed Escape by se měl vrátit do hlavní oblasti
Položky panelu Cyklovat pomocí Tab; obrátit pomocí Shift+Tab Potřebné pro uvážlivé používání
Zrušit ovládání Fokus zůstává viditelný; Escape ukončí vyvaruje se uvěznění uživatele

Správa zaostřování: zachycení zaostření při otevření a návrat při zavření

Recommendation: Po zobrazení přesuňte fokus na první ovladací prvek uvnitř panelu, na který lze fokus přesunout. Vytvořte past, která omezí cyklické přepínání pomocí Tab na danou oblast. Uložte odkaz na spouštěcí prvek pro obnovení fokusu po skrytí.

Kroky implementace: Připojte posluchače události keydown k panelu; při stisku Tab, pokud je fokus na posledním prvku, na který lze fokus přesunout, přesměrujte na první; při stisku Shift+Tab, pokud je fokus na prvním, přesměrujte na poslední. Tím se udrží fokus uvnitř a zabrání se úniku do obsahu na pozadí.

Řízení ukončení: Po propuštění vraťte fokus na spouštěcí ovládací prvek; odstraňte past; zajistěte obnovení předchozího cíle fokusu, aby uživatelé klávesnice mohli nerušeně pokračovat v práci.

Kontext pro cestovatele: Pro itineráře po havajských ostrovech, jejichž harmonogramy se liší v závislosti na povětrnostních podmínkách, by plány měly zahrnovat čtyři cestující, kteří se v pátek přesouvají přes Nuʻuuli. Upřednostňovány musí být nejméně ohrožené trasy; možnosti dopravy se pohybují od letů po místní trajekty; měly by být nabídnuty nejdostupnější a nejlevnější možnosti. Praktický souhrn zahrnuje náklady, čas, bezpečnost; teplé počasí, vyhýbání se žralokům, úvahy o repelentech, zastávky na vaření, přestávky na ostrovech mohou utvářet nabídku. Seznam aktivit by měl být omezen na bezpečné a snadno zvládnutelné zážitky; čekací doby musí být minimalizovány, zejména při překračování mezi vzdálenými břehy; dobře navržený plán se vyhýbá nudě, únavě; špatným zkušenostem.

Poznámky k testování: Ověřte navigaci pomocí klávesnice na různých zařízeních; ověřte, zda se fokus přesune na zamýšlenou položku po zobrazení; potvrďte obnovení po zavření; zkontrolujte, zda obsah na pozadí zůstává neaktivní, dokud je panel viditelný.

Responzivní chování: mobilní zásuvka versus horizontální menu na desktopu

Doporučení: implementujte mobilní zásuvku pro úzké obrazovky; přepněte na vodorovnou hlavičku pro stolní počítače přibližně při 900 px; toto se soustředí na hlavní obsah; udržuje informace o ostrovech na dosah.

Omezení: nespoléhejte se na jediné zařízení; sbalte si cestovní poznámky pro rychlou orientaci; ikona medosavky označuje hlavní vstupní bod.

  1. Konfigurace mobilní zásuvky: práh přibližně 900 px; zásuvka se otevírá zleva; uvnitř se zobrazují čtyři primární položky; ikony včetně medosavky; cíle dotyku zůstávají velké; odsazení se zmenšuje při menších šířkách; zajistěte odkaz pro přeskočení hlavního obsahu; zajistěte, aby focus zůstal viditelný při přepínání.
  2. Horizontální záhlaví plochy: při 900px a více, čtyři hlavní odkazy seřadí do řady; žádné zalomení; použijte kontrastní barvy; udržujte viditelnost bezpečnosti; základní rozvržení; mezery kolem ikon snižují rušení; stabilní popisky pro rychlé rozpoznání.
  3. Obsahová strategie: udržovat informace srozumitelné pro návštěvu ostrovů; cesty mezi ostrovy; horská scenérie; útesy; vysoké dominanty; výhled; základní popisy; pozdní aktualizace; ostatní stránky dostupné přes mobilní zásuvku; ostrovy se zarostlými cestami; hostely; lety; nabídky.
  4. Řízení údržby: vládní směrnice ovlivňují rozvržení; příležitosti pro váš obsah; dodržujte přibližně čtyři sekce; signály uživatelům prostřednictvím orientačních bodů; bezpečnost zůstává prioritou; struktura balíčku snižuje kognitivní zátěž; vše zůstává rychle prohledatelné.

Zpětná vazba čtečky obrazovky a živé oblasti pro stav nabídky

Implementujte vyhrazený živý region připojený k přepínači, který spravuje viditelnost panelu; oznamujte dvě fráze: “Panel zobrazen” po zobrazení; “Panel skryt” po skrytí; udržujte latenci aktualizace pod 300 ms.

Nastavte aria-live=”polite” s aria-atomic=”true”, abyste zajistili, že čtečka při každé změně doručí celou větu; pro urgentní přechody dočasně přepněte na aria-live=”assertive”.

Umístěte oblast vedle přepínače, text zkraťte; zprávy jako “Panel zobrazen” nebo “Panel skryt” snižují kognitivní zátěž; změřte průměrný čas potvrzení napříč zařízeními; uživatelé stráví 250 ms až 400 ms čtením aktualizací.

Test s NVDA; VoiceOver; TalkBack; ověřte, zda se aktualizace zobrazují při přepínání panelu; zajistěte, aby se fokus udržel na spouštěči nebo se po změně pohyboval předvídatelně.

Ráno v havajském ráji se vyznačuje mnohobarevným přílivem; proudy přicházejí a odcházejí; medosavka volá poblíž taro na Aunuʻu; svačinky pola odpočívají poblíž; mraky, které přinášejí déšť, stoupají; déšť padá; roční období se mění; většinou opravdu klid; dochází k lijákům; nerozptylují se čtenáři; signály Leone blikají na obrazovkách, jak se aktualizují počty obyvatel; zachyťte menší hodnoty ve čtvercových blocích; celkový počet zobrazených položek zůstává snadný; běžné obrázky informují o tónu; do měsíčních zpráv, do UX dashboardů.

Produkční kontrolní seznam: připojte vizuálně skryté označení popisující stav panelu; zajistěte, aby se zprávy aktualizovaly při každém přepnutí viditelnosti; zaznamenávejte latenci, čitelnost a míru přeskočení pro měsíční revize.

Měřte odolnost napříč zařízeními; udržujte jednotné znění; aktualizujte styl, když testy odhalí odchylky; zdokumentujte základní hodnoty pro budoucí audity.